def func(a, b, x): return (x - a) * (x - b) N = 10000 a, b = [int(w) for w in input().split()] d = b-a ans = 0 for i in range(N): ans += abs(func(a, b, a + d * i / N)) # print(a+d*i/N," ",func(a, b, a + d * i / N)) ans = ans * d / N print(ans)